Expungement is the legal process by which a criminal record is either sealed or destroyed after a certain period of time has lapsed. If your record has been expunged, you may be able to apply for a job without reporting a prior criminal conviction.
Expunging Your Record in Framingham
Under normal circumstances, the process of expunging your record involves completing the correct paperwork, getting the court documents of your original case, and then filing with the court in Framingham, Massachusetts
However, not every state allows expungment, nor is every crime capable of being expunged. This process can be complicated depending upon your past history with law enforcement and prior convictions.
